On Tue, Apr 23, 2019 at 02:58:11PM +0530, Manikanta Maddireddy wrote: > The logic which blocks read requests till AFI gets ACK for all outstanding > writes from memory controller does not behave correctly when number of > outstanding writes become more than 32 in Tegra124 and Tegra132. > > SW fixup is to prevent writes from accumulating more than 32 by, > - limiting outstanding posted writes to 14 > - modifying Gen1 and Gen2 UpdateFC timer frequency > > UpdateFC timer frequency is equal to twice the value of register content > in nsec. These settings are recommended after stress testing with different > values. > > Signed-off-by: Manikanta Maddireddy <mmaddireddy@xxxxxxxxxx> > --- > V2: Changed update_fc_val to update_fc_threshold > > drivers/pci/controller/pci-tegra.c | 34 ++++++++++++++++++++++++++++++ > 1 file changed, 34 insertions(+) Acked-by: Thierry Reding <treding@xxxxxxxxxx>
Attachment:
signature.asc
Description: PGP signature